Salary overview
Median pay for this occupation in Ohio is $33,420 a year, trailing the national median of $41,800 by 20.0%. The middle half of workers in this occupation earn between $30,180 and $42,440. The lowest tenth earn under $27,950, while the highest tenth earn more than $49,340.
The area has 210 jobs in this occupation, which works out to 0.0 of every thousand jobs. Ohio ranks number 37th out of 37 states by median pay for this occupation. Within the state, Cincinnati records the highest median at $38,660. Of the 774 occupations with published wages in this area, it sits 738th.

What the pay is worth locally
Prices in Ohio run 7.2% below the national average, so the median of $33,420 goes as far as $36,013 would elsewhere in the country. Measured that way it compares to the national median at 13.8% below the national median in real terms.
